【已解决】Xcode在StoryBoard设置UIView的控件类是Cocoapods的类,运行还是UIView?


typora-copy-images-to: ipic

Xcode在StoryBoard设置UIView的控件类是Cocoapods的类,运行还是UIView?

问题产生的条件:

ZHVerifyCodeFiled作为我写在Cocoapods的空间,现在我在测试例子的Main.storyboard直接添加一个UIView使用我们Cocoapods的这个类,但是我们运行发现出来的对象还是UIView类。

80CE5494-BF6B-4BD4-B6E8-BA300CD8E073

如果我在代码导入这个类

import ZHVerifyCodeFiled

直接使用代码创建时可以创建成功的。

下面是这个类的初始化方法

public required init(number:Int, frame:CGRect = CGRect.zero) {
    self.item = number
    super.init(frame: frame)
    self.collectionView.frame = frame
    self.addSubview(self.collectionView)
}


public convenience override init(frame: CGRect) {
    self.init(number: 4, frame: frame)
}

public convenience required init?(coder aDecoder: NSCoder) {
    self.init(number: 4)
}

## 解决办法

16745825-D94E-4EE7-B838-CA0D2DBF4A5A

使用类的Module要使用包含我们使用类的Module才可以

最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容

  • 发现 关注 消息 iOS 第三方库、插件、知名博客总结 作者大灰狼的小绵羊哥哥关注 2017.06.26 09:4...
    肇东周阅读 12,245评论 4 61
  • 玩,我的生活,我的生存。
    庄德坤阅读 179评论 0 0
  • 当你看到赵被灭族只剩遗腹子的时候,你是否满心的绝望?在无数个漆黑的夜晚,你可曾跪下为这孩子祈祷?你又何曾不珍惜自己...
    奢侈基因阅读 262评论 0 2
  • 又是一年秋天到,今天不同的是感觉腿脚迟钝了,看书写字眼也花了。然,春华秋实,想想正是人们喜获丰收的日子,又觉得...
    叶禄青阅读 3,088评论 3 31